Frequently Asked Questions about South San Pedro
What type of rentals are currently available in South San Pedro?
There are currently 165 Apartments for Rent in South San Pedro, NM with pricing that ranges from $645 to $1,567. There are also 4 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in South San Pedro ranging from $850 to $1,875.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in South San Pedro?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in South San Pedro ranges from $850 to $1,875 with an average monthly rent of $1,375.
